Why not copy the music to your phone then stream it over Bluetooth using the music playing app on your phone? That app will have shuffle mode, playlists, play a single album, many many possibilities.

As long as you have enough space on your phone...

Plus you have your music with you wherever you go. Pair your phone with your rental car and you've got it there too!

With Vista and 7 not allowing FAT 16/32 to be an option for drives larger than 32gb, this will allow you to use your USB powered hard drive for music. Apple computers should be able to format their drives w/o the below program.

This SHOULD work on any usb powered mini drive of any size.

Mine is a Seagate 250gb

Download Download Fat32Formatter 1.0 - A software utility that helps you format drive larger than 32 GB to FAT32 - Softpedia
Unzip the program, open it and select the drive you want (ensuring there is nothing on the drive, it will be erased).
Click on the start button in the lower right corner.
Wait 2-5 hours depending on the size.

Add all the music you want in MP3 and WMA format. I made folders for specific artists, but if you just want random music or folders for different types of music you can do that as well.

No more than 255 songs in a folder.

When I had my thumb drive plugged in, when I would turn the engine on, it would go directly to the drive. With the USB powered hard drive, since it takes a second or 2 to turn on, the 4runner will go to the default audio you had it on last, so you have to select the USB option to go to it.

Once playing, hold down the random button for a second or 2, and it will cycle through ALL folders of music.

Thanks for the reply. It wound up being that I was using a 3.1 USB flash drive that had my FLAC files on it. I purchased a 512GB 2.0 USB flash drive and the system can read the files just fine.
